Transaction 57e15c126566b69f4c3f678f71b43d6d95544f0132b5577d6ec421ab747d7c28

1 Input
1 Outputs
  • 57e15c126566b69f4c3f678f71b43d6d95544f0132b5577d6ec421ab747d7c28:0
  • value  124359
    address  18oQvAneFv8cxox9Je5HtUVc78Wpzfd89c